How they compare

Palestine currently reports 15,412 1000 USD against 15,069 1000 USD in Malta, a difference of 343 1000 USD.

Across all 11 years both countries report, Palestine has been ahead every year.

Malta ranks 115th and Palestine ranks 114th of 219 countries.

Palestine has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Malta Palestine Difference Ahead
2010s 4,636 1000 USD 13,272 1000 USD 8,636 1000 USD Palestine
2020s 8,973 1000 USD 19,480 1000 USD 10,506 1000 USD Palestine

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
